Joseph John Gaska, Jr., 78, of Brunswick passed away May 31, 2026, at UF Health in Jacksonville, FL.

Born on September 13, 1947, to Joseph John and Josephine Urban Gaska, he was the oldest of their children. Raised in the Catholic faith in Utica, New York, he graduated from Notre Dame High School before enrolling at George Washington University. His college education was interrupted when he was drafted into the United States Army. He proudly served his country for more than 20 years, earned a degree from American Graduate University during his military career, and retired with the rank of Master Sergeant.

Joe met Phyllis in Italy in 1978 while he was serving in the Army and she was serving in the Navy. Throughout their 36-year marriage, they shared a love of travel, exploring the country and the world together, and even beginning their married life with a wedding in Las Vegas.

After retiring from the Army, Joe returned to the private sector, working for Rowe Research Corporation before accepting a position with Adelphia Corp., which eventually brought him to Brunswick. He later earned his real estate license, became an associate broker, and served for many years on the Board of Equalization. Joe was deeply committed to his community and was a longtime active member of the Brunswick Exchange Club and the American Legion. He also volunteered with the United Way and supported numerous civic activities throughout the area.

Joe was a very caring person, especially with his family and friends. An avid reader, he especially enjoyed the suspense and legal thrillers of David Baldacci, appreciating the way real-life events were woven into works of fiction. He also loved spending time outdoors hunting and fishing and was a devoted fan of the Buffalo Sabres and Buffalo Bills. He will be remembered for his wonderful sense of humor - unless the topic was politics, then he became all business.

He was preceded in death by his parents and his brothers Jeff and Christopher Gaska.

He is survived by his wife of 36 years, Phyllis Gaska of Brunswick; sisters, Mary Gaska Callahan of Virginia Beach, VA, and Anne Gaska Grazadire (Kevin) of Oriskany, NY; brothers, Larry Gaska (Bonnie) of Hudson Falls, NY, Bruce Gaska (Gloria) of Utica, NY, and Mike Gaska (Cathy) of Clinton, NY; godson, Michael Gaska; and several nieces and nephews.

A Memorial Mass will begin at 1:30 p.m., Saturday, July 18, 2026, at Church of Our Lady of Lourdes, 2222 Genesee St, Utica, NY 13502. Inurnment will be in Arlington National Cemetery in a private service.
